Introduction to iPhone 13 Pro Max Camera

Outdoor shoots demand gear that keeps up. The iPhone 13 Pro Max packs a versatile triple-camera system that shines in natural settings. The main wide, the ultra-wide, and the telephoto options give a photographer flexible framing without lugging heavy gear. Sensor-shift stabilization steadies every frame, delivering crisp detail as subjects move through wind and shade. Night mode across all lenses works across the system, so dusk scenes stay usable. ProRAW and ProRes add post-work options for designers who want latitude in color and texture. This makes the device reliable for quick lookbooks outdoors and for casual storytelling. With a little planning, it captures fabric drape, weave, and stitching in sunlight or under a cloud break, helping decisions stay creative rather than costly. Utilizing Photography Modes on iPhone

Portrait mode elevates models and garments with flattering depth, but it also strips away distractions for a cleaner look outdoors. Macro mode brings textures up close—zippers, knits, and embroidery become tactile details that sell the design. ProRes video records higher color fidelity and smoother motion, which helps when capturing motion at the edge of a hill or a windy field. The iPhone 13 Pro Max shines here because switching between modes feels seamless, letting the shoot flow instead of breaking rhythm. Creative Angles and Compositions

Creative angles turn simple outfits into stories. Try a few low-angle shots to exaggerate flowing fabrics as they catch a breeze and stretch toward the sky. Move in for a close-up of stitching and fabric weave to emphasize craftsmanship. A diagonal composition across rocks or a wooden fence can add motion without motion blur. The key is to shoot in bursts, then pick the strongest frames that tell the designer’s idea. These ideas work well in natural settings where textures matter most. Editing and Enhancing Photos on iPhone

Editing on iPhone is about sharpening details without overdoing it. Use brightness and contrast to bring out the garment’s color under varied light while keeping skin tones natural. Color adjustments can boost the fabric’s warmth or coolness to fit the vibe, but it’s easy to overdo, so apply gently. Filters, when used sparingly, can unify a lookbook’s mood, yet keep the texture visible. Remember to check realism on a small screen and compare with the real world setting. Common Challenges and Solutions

Outdoor shoots routinely throw curveballs like gusts of wind, changing light, and inconsistent backdrops. Wind management becomes essential for crisp textures, while the phone’s stabilization helps when a jogger passes by or a flag flaps in the breeze. A steady stance and a quick burst of shots can save the moment before the subject moves. Shifting light requires fast adjustments and a few tested presets to keep skin tones believable. Always have a backup plan, extra batteries, and a spare location ready in case conditions deteriorate.
